FIRES AT GISBORNE.

(By Telegraph'—-Tress Association.) GJSBORNIB, Monday. There has been an epidemic of fires during the week-end, no less than five being reported in the district since Saturday. On Sunday a small house at Ma tn where, occupied by Mr Mathieson, w;i s destroyed, and at Pafcutuhi Charles MeGannigan's house was burned to the ground. Later, ai Oiu:oiui, a cottage occupied l>y Mr AY. H. Jones eiught fire, and a bedroom was burned. This afternoon a house, in .Lytton Road, occupied Hv Thomas Bartlett, was destroyed. All tJiese minor fires were eclipsed this evening by. an outbreak at the g\« works, when, as the result of a hitv-h.in the system between the retorts and the refiner, a huge jet of gas ignited, and set, fire to a sfttrroumliug building. The engine house and engine boiler were badly damaged, and the men's change room amd bath room were destroyed, together with the men's clothing what effects ihoy had i:i their ,;"ckets. on the gas works are snren-d over a number of offices, a"nd are not available to-night. Though the damage was pretty severs, the. efficiency of the i\e !

not impaired, and the production of g:is wil'i go on as usual. During the fire one of the gas company's employees, named J. Beattie, was somewhat severely burned.
